How are wastes carried to the kidney for removal?
stich3 [128]

Answer:

The correct option is: c. in blood

Explanation:

A kidney is a bean-shaped organ, that is present below rib cage in the retroperitoneal space. In vertebrates, the kidneys are present in pair. Each kidney receives blood from the paired renal arteries. The main function of a kidney is to filter the urea present in the blood with the help of filtering units, called the nephrons.

There are three checkpoints in the cell cycle what is the role.
Tanzania [10]

The 3 checkpoints include G1 where the cell growth is checked, G2 where the integrity of the DNA/chromosome is checked, and M where the integrity of the metaphase plate is checked.

<h3>Cell cycle checkpoints</h3>

There are 3 regulatory checkpoints in the life cycle of cells:

  • G1: the size of the cell, the presence of growth factors, and the integrity of the DNA are checked before the cell irreversibly commits to division.
  • G2: the integrity of the DNA and the correctness of the replication process at the S-phase are checked.
  • M: correct attachment of the spindle fibers to the chromosomes at the metaphase plate is checked.
